2006 FIFA World Cup was hosted by Germany. UEFA is allocated 13 places and Germany as hosts in the FIFA World Cup Finals. They were filled with
- Czech Republic
- Netherlands
- Spain
- Portugal
- France
- England
- Italy
- Sweden
- Germany (HOST)
- Croatia
- Poland
- Switzerland
- Serbia and Montenegro
- Ukraine
Group Stage[]
The top 2 in each group advanced to the knockout stage. UEFA countries were group winners in 6 of the 8 groups. Only 4 UEFA countries - Poland, Serbia and Montenegro, Czech Republic, Croatia - failed to reach the knockout stage.

Knockout Stage[]
Ten UEFA countries advanced to the knockout stage with all semi finalists UEFA countries. Italy defeated France in the final to become the 2006 champions beating Ukraine and Germany on route. Whilst Germany won the third place play-off against Portugal.
